1

Thinking Slate? Here's What a Pleasant Hill Roofer Suggests

News Discuss 
Key Variables to Take Into Consideration When Selecting an Expert for Your Roof Choosing the ideal specialist for a roof covering job includes cautious consideration of a number of important factors. Experience with numerous roof materials is crucial, as is a strong credibility backed by consumer testimonials. Licensing and insurance https://sethjrkzs.blogrenanda.com/42334068/benefits-of-slate-roofing-explained-by-a-pleasant-hill-roofing-contractor

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story